BERNARD SUCHOCKI 

Linder, NJ

I was a big kid my whole life. My weight was always an issue. I turned to sports and played football through college. After I graduated I decided to lose weight because I was about 300 pounds. I crash dieted and got down to 205 pounds in about one year. I was happy with the gains but that was the beginning of my yo-yo dieting story.

Over the next 10 years I would lose weight and gain it back. It was horrible to not be able to keep the weight off. I was in a vicious cycle. I was also binge drinking and using drugs during that decade. My health got so bad that I was over 350 pounds and wore 56 inch pants. I was on blood pressure medicine, had high cholesterol and prediabetic. I knew I needed a change because my life was miserable. That's when I decided to get my shit together and get back to the gym.

I started strength training consistently and doing cardio. I also stopped drinking alcohol and haven't had a drink in 5 years. I started doing a lot of research and experimenting with nutrition and training. I ate all types of diets. Low carb, high carb, low fat, high fat, high protein, vegetarian, vegan, and the list goes on and on. I finally decided to eat real food with moderation. I shop the produce and perimeter sections of the supermarket. I strength train 1-3 times per week and cardio 1-3 times per week.

I've had consistent gains and I it turned my journey in to a business. I coach warriors to improve their physical, mental, and spiritual health.
